To provide a private right of action for persons harmed by violations of the Franchise Rule of the Federal Trade Commission, and for other purposes.

Summary
This bill creates a private right of action for individuals harmed by violations of the Federal Trade Commission's Franchise Rule. The rule requires franchisors to disclose certain relevant information to prospective franchisees.
